Choosing the Right Broken Tooth Repair Kit: A Buyer’s Guide
Accidents happen. Sometimes, a small chip or a broken piece of a tooth surprises you. A broken tooth repair kit can be a temporary fix until you see your dentist. These kits offer a quick solution to cover sharp edges or restore a bit of your tooth’s shape. Knowing what to look for helps you pick the best temporary solution.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ping for a kit, certain features make a big difference in how well it works. Look for these important points:
- Ease of Use: The best kits are simple to mix and apply. You should not need special tools or a dental degree to use them.
- Color Matching: A good kit often includes shades or a material that closely matches your natural tooth color. A poorly matched repair looks very obvious.
- Durability (Temporary): While these are not permanent solutions, the material should hold its shape long enough for you to reach your dentist. It should not crumble immediately when you eat soft foods.
- Safety Certification: Ensure the materials used are non-toxic and safe for temporary contact with your mouth.
Important Materials in Repair Kits
Most temporary tooth repair kits use one of two main types of material. Understanding these helps you choose the right feel and setting time.
Composite Resin Materials
Many modern kits use a type of dental composite resin. This material is often applied as a putty or paste. When exposed to air or warm water, it hardens. These resins are generally stronger and look more natural than older materials.
Thermoplastic Beads (e.g., Polymorph)
Some kits contain small plastic beads. You heat these beads in hot water until they become soft and moldable. You shape the soft material over the broken area. As it cools, it solidifies. This material is very popular because it is easy to reshape if you make a mistake.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
The quality of a temporary repair kit varies widely. A high-quality kit provides a better temporary hold and appearance.
What Makes a Kit Better?
- Good Adhesion: The material must stick firmly to the remaining tooth structure. Weak adhesion means the repair falls out quickly.
- Fine Particle Size: If the material uses powder or resin, smaller particles usually result in a smoother, less noticeable repair.
- Clear Instructions: Excellent, step-by-step instructions guarantee you use the product correctly.
What Lowers the Quality?
- Poor Color Match: If the material is stark white or yellow, it will stand out badly against your natural teeth.
- Brittleness: If the material sets too hard and brittle, it might crack or chip off under slight pressure.
- Complex Mixing: Kits that require precise measuring of two different chemicals often lead to user error and a failed repair.
User Experience and Use Cases
These kits are best used in specific situations. They are designed as a stop-gap measure, not a permanent fix.
Ideal Use Cases:
You should use a kit if you have chipped a small piece of enamel while eating or if a filling has fallen out just before a big event. They help cover sharp edges that might cut your tongue or cheek. They also restore the look of your smile temporarily.
What to Avoid:
Do not rely on these kits for large breaks or if the tooth is severely cracked down to the root. These kits cannot handle heavy chewing forces. If you have significant pain or bleeding, skip the kit and seek emergency dental care immediately.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Broken Tooth Repair Kits
Q: How long will a temporary tooth repair last?
A: Most temporary repairs last from a few hours up to a few days. They are meant only to cover the damage until you see a dentist. Heavy chewing will likely break the repair sooner.
Q: Can I eat normally with the repair in place?
A: You should eat very carefully. Stick to soft foods like yogurt or soup. Avoid hard, sticky, or very hot foods, as these put stress on the temporary material.
Q: Is it safe to use these materials inside my mouth?
A: Yes, if you buy a reputable kit. The materials are usually medical-grade or food-safe plastic designed for short-term oral contact. Always check for safety seals.
Q: How do I clean the repair site before applying the material?
A: Gently rinse the area with warm water to remove any loose debris. Dry the tooth surface carefully with a clean, dry cloth or gauze. A dry surface helps the material stick better.
Q: What if the color doesn’t match my tooth at all?
A: If the color is very wrong, the repair will look noticeable. Some kits offer multiple shades. If yours only has one, try to apply a very thin layer, as thin layers tend to be less obvious than thick globs.
Q: Do these kits hurt when they fall out?
A: Usually, no. The material simply detaches when you eat or brush. The main issue is that the sharp edge of the broken tooth might become exposed again.
Q: Are these kits suitable for fixing a crown that has fallen off?
A: Some kits can temporarily cement a loose crown back on for a few hours. However, never use the filling material itself to stick a crown on; use the specific temporary cement provided in the kit, if available.
Q: Will this material wash away when I brush my teeth?
A: Gentle brushing is usually fine, but you must be careful around the repaired area. Aggressive brushing can easily dislodge the temporary filling.
Q: Where should I store the unused material?
A: Store the kit in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ight. Check the package instructions; some materials need to be kept at room temperature, while others should be kept cool.
Q: When should I stop using the kit and go straight to the dentist?
A: If you experience throbbing pain, swelling in your gums or face, or if the break is deep and exposes the pink part of your tooth (the pulp), stop using the kit and contact a dentist right away.
